Description of LHC data in a soft interaction model

Abstract

We show in this paper that we have found a set of parameters in our model for the soft interactions at high energy, that successfully describes all high energy experimental data, including the LHC data. This model is based on a single Pomeron with large intercept = 0.23 and slope α' = 0, that describes both long and short distance processes. It also provides a natural matching with perturbative QCD. All features of our model are similar to the expectations of N=4 SYM, which at present is the only theory that is able to treat srong interactions on a theoretical basis.
